Transaction e3676e221e32c34818d0bf401db678eaf8dc04837d6695ad33dedca801053d97
1 Input
1 Output
-
e3676e221e32c34818d0bf401db678eaf8dc04837d6695ad33dedca801053d97:0
- value
- 52650731
- script pubkey
- OP_0 OP_PUSHBYTES_20 528e5619f2617426c00804b48848ca11292ffe6c
- address
- bc1q2289vx0jv96zdsqgqj6gsjx2zy5jllnvuhv9jn